Plumbing system replacement services involve removing outdated or damaged plumbing infrastructure and installing new pipes, fixtures, and related components. This process often includes assessing the existing plumbing layout, removing old or corroded pipes, and installing modern, durable materials designed for longevity and improved performance. The service aims to upgrade systems to meet current standards, enhance efficiency, and prevent future problems caused by aging or faulty plumbing.

Replacing a plumbing system can address a range of issues, including persistent leaks, low water pressure, frequent clogs, and pipe corrosion. Over time, pipes can deteriorate due to age, mineral buildup, or exposure to harsh conditions, leading to costly repairs or water damage. A comprehensive replacement helps mitigate these risks by providing a reliable plumbing network that reduces the likelihood of emergencies and minimizes ongoing maintenance needs.

The overview below groups typical Plumbing System Replacement proj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Essex County, MA.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Basic Replacement - The cost for replacing a standard residential plumbing system typically ranges from $3,000 to $8,000, depending on the size and complexity of the project. For example, replacing a few pipes in a small home may be closer to the lower end. Larger or more complex systems can increase the overall expense.

Mid-Range Systems - Upgrading to more advanced plumbing systems usually falls within $8,000 to $15,000. This includes higher-quality materials and additional features, such as modern fixtures or upgraded piping components.

High-End Installations - For extensive or custom plumbing replacements, costs can range from $15,000 to $30,000 or more. These projects often involve significant modifications, including rerouting pipes or integrating new technology.

Additional Costs - Factors such as accessibility, existing pipe condition, and local labor rates can influence overall costs. Contact local service providers to get precise estimates tailored to specific project needs.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

Plumbing system replacement services are commonly sought by property owners in Essex County, MA, when older pipes or fixtures begin to show signs of deterioration. Leaking pipes, frequent clogs, or reduced water pressure can indicate the need for a complete upgrade to ensure reliable water flow and prevent potential water damage. Additionally, outdated plumbing materials, such as galvanized pipes, may no longer meet modern standards and can pose health or safety concerns, prompting homeowners to consider professional replacement.

Other situations prompting plumbing system replacement include remodeling projects that require updated fixtures or layouts, as well as the discovery of corrosion or rust within existing pipes. Property owners may also opt for replacement when installing new appliances or fixtures that demand different plumbing configurations.
